Abstract
We analyzed psychotherapeutic effectiveness of and individual clinical reactions to hyperventilation sessions used for emotional stress correction in 517 patients including 211 pilots and 306 war veterans at the age of 22 to 52 years. The hyperventilation method was recommended for pilots' treatment in hospitals and rehabilitation centers. However, the method may provoke convulsive activities in the brain and personal disorientation and, therefore, should be prescribed on the clinical evidence of benefit to an individuum with post-traumatic stress disorders, and lack of contraindications.
